PHP基于传入参数合并多个js和CSS文件的简单实现

HTML(使用方法):
复制代码代码如下所示:


PHP:
将代码复制如下:
标题(内容类型:应用程序/ x-javascript;UTF-8字符:);
如果(isset($ _get)){
$文件=爆炸()
$ =;
foreach(美元美元美元关键文件= val){
$str = file_get_contents($ _get { 'path}。$ Val);
}

$str = str_replace( T
$str = str_replace( R
$str = str_replace(

删除/注释
$str = preg_replace( / / / * { a-za-z0-9_ x7f - xff } { a-za-z0-9_ x7f - xff } * /
删除/多行注释
$str = preg_replace( / / * { ^ / } * * / /

回声$;
}

输出
标题(内容类型:文本/ CSS;UTF-8字符:);
如果(isset($ _get)){
$文件=爆炸()
$ =;
foreach(美元美元美元关键文件= val){
FC = file_get_contents美元(美元_get { 'path}。美元价值。CSS);
}
str_replace(FC =美元 T
str_replace(FC =美元 R
美元 str_replace(FC =
preg_replace(FC =美元 / / * { ^ / } * * / /
回声$ FC;
}
它只是一个简单的原型,没有封装。此外,合并的文件还记得缓存。